My wife & I had an extremely disappointing experience at Mikado Montreal.
Before coming, I called the restaurant at approximately 8:30 PM to confirm whether it would be acceptable for us to arrive at 9:30 PM, knowing the restaurant closes at 10:00 PM. I specifically explained that we intended to order immediately upon arrival so the staff could still close on time. We simply wanted a quick sushi dinner & had chosen Mikado based on recommendations from several friends.
When we arrived at 9:30 PM, the bartender greeted us politely & kindly mentioned that he would check with the kitchen to ensure they were still serving. While waiting, a waitress looked at us from across the restaurant & made a dismissive gesture indicating that they were closed. She then approached us & bluntly said,'We're closed. Sorry. There's nothing we can do.'
I explained that I had called in advance specifically to avoid making the trip unnecessarily. Her response was,'That's not my problem.' She made it very clear that the situation was of no concern to her.
What made the interaction even more confusing was that the restaurant was clearly not empty. There were guests seated in the front section, several more by the windows, & I was informed there was another group dining inside. From what I could see, there were at least 10-15 customers still being served.
As a result, it was difficult not to feel singled out. The only difference I could identify was that I was dressed casually after a long day of work, wearing shorts & a hoodie. My wife was well dressed in heels, jeans, & a nice coat. Whether appearance played a role or not, the experience certainly left that impression.
What disappointed me most was not being turned away it was the attitude & complete lack of professionalism. A restaurant that prides itself on quality, hospitality, & attention to detail should understand that the way guests are treated at the door is just as important as the food served at the table.
Based on this experience, I cannot recommend Mikado. The bartender was courteous & professional, but unfortunately the interaction with the waitress completely overshadowed what should have been a pleasant evening.
